    Default Weakfish in the Ambrose.

    I haven't caught a tiderunner in SH, Chapel Hill or Ambrose area in years.
    This time last year, not targeting weaks and caught a total of 5 spikes, and they of course went back.
    Last week, a couple of us got three weakfish of 17" and 18"
    near the 21 can & VZ.
    Slack water for the weakfish bite. Hope they're making a comeback.
    Had a few NY keeper fluke too, and a bunch of NJ legal fish we had to throw back in NY waters.
    Plenty of 15's, 16's & 17's there too.
